<p>The Train HVAC (Heating, Ventilation, and Air Conditioning) market is growing significantly due to the increasing demand for efficient and sustainable climate control systems in trains. Train HVAC systems are essential in providing a comfortable and safe environment for passengers and freight. The market is segmented by application into Passenger Trains and Freight Trains, each with distinct requirements and growth trajectories. Passenger trains focus on passenger comfort and air quality, while freight trains prioritize cost-effective and robust climate control to protect goods during transportation. Unlike passenger trains, where comfort is the key priority, HVAC systems in freight trains are more concerned with maintaining the right conditions to preserve the integrity of sensitive goods, such as perishable items or hazardous materials. As freight rail services grow globally, especially in regions with large export markets, the demand for robust and reliable HVAC solutions is increasing. The systems must be durable, energy-efficient, and capable of handling extreme external weather conditions without compromising the safety of goods. The integration of IoT and advanced sensors into HVAC systems allows real-time monitoring of the internal environment, helping to mitigate risks of spoilage or damage to sensitive cargo. With the global push towards sustainability, rail operators and manufacturers are focusing on developing HVAC systems that reduce energy consumption and carbon emissions. For example, the incorporation of heat recovery systems and the use of environmentally friendly refrigerants are becoming increasingly popular in modern train HVAC systems. This shift not only helps in complying with stricter regulations but also reduces operational costs in the long term.
